Auto Centre Manager

4 months ago


Greater Manchester, United Kingdom Department of Recruitment Full time

We are looking to recruit an Autocentre Manager on a permanent basis this is an excellent opportunity for an experienced team leader or existing Manager looking for a new challenge. Great team environment and supportive management.

Working Hours are as follows:

Monday to Friday 08.30 to 18.00 & Saturday 08.30 to 17.00, with a day off in the week.

Sunday is a trading day, to be agreed at local level with a supplementary payment.

In Addition:

  • Bonus Incentive Scheme
  • NEST Pension Scheme
  • Life Insurance Scheme
  • Safety boots and Uniform
  • Staff Discount
  • On going training and career progression.

Role Responsibilities:

To adhere to the Company’s Policies & Procedures including Health & Safety, Compliance and Stock Control

  • Ensure that Customers receive the best Customer Service and care to ensure that complaints are kept to a minimum
  • To ensure all sales targets and KPI’s are achieved
  • To maintain the cleanliness of the Centre and its equipment on an ongoing basis
  • To comply with reasonable instruction from Regional Managers, Head Office or the Board of Directors
  • To increase sales of products and services offered by the Company, in accordance with procedures
  • Recruit and interview all employees for the Centre
  • Liaise with Head Office and other Departments
  • Support other Centres, when asked, when necessary
  • Identify any training needs for employees to progress and develop within the Company
  • To be available for work at the times specified by the Company

There are training opportunities to further your career within the Company.
